Description
For moving ahead ship needs thrust, which is generated by rotating propeller behind its hull. Propellers are used to generate thrust to propel marine vehicles. Propeller generates thrust by virtue of the pressure difference between two surfaces of the propeller blade, called face and back. The incident angle of the flow plays a major role in generating this pressure difference over every blade section (which is an aerofoil section in general). A controllable pitch propeller can adjust incidence of incoming flow and can offer better control over the thrust generated by it.Traditionally thrust and torque of a propeller, is predicted by model test. This takes more time,manpower, space and cost. In present time CFD is getting popular for hydrodynamic designs as it give relative saving in time, manpower, space and cost.
